Franco Mastantuono

Franco Mastantuono is an Argentine profess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for La Liga club Real Madrid and the Argentina national team. He was trained in Club Atletico River Plate's academy, the team which he would debut in the Argentine Primera División in 2023. Since 2025, he has been a member of the Argentina national team. Wikipedia
